One Day in Mysore - Saturday, September 30, 2023

8:00 AM: Mysore Palace

Start your day at the magnificent Mysore Palace, also known as the Amba Vilas Palace. It is the official residence of the Wadiyar dynasty and a breathtaking example of Indo-Saracenic architecture. Explore the opulent halls, ornate ceilings, and beautiful artworks that adorn this grand palace. Admission fee: INR 50 for Indian tourists, INR 200 for foreign tourists. Time spent: 2 hours.

10:00 AM: Chamundi Hill

Head to Chamundi Hill, located just a short drive from the city. Climb the 1,000 steps to the top or take a short drive up to witness the beauty of the Chamundeshwari Temple. Enjoy panoramic views of Mysore from the hilltop and marvel at the massive Nandi statue. Entry to the temple is free, and it takes around 1 hour to explore.

12:00 PM: Lunch at Hotel RRR

Indulge in a delicious South Indian lunch at Hotel RRR, known for its authentic Mysore cuisine. Relish local delicacies like masala dosa, idli sambar, and Mysore pak. The average cost for a meal here ranges from INR 150 to INR 300 per person. Allow around 1 hour for the meal.

2:00 PM: Mysore Zoo

Visit the famous Mysore Zoo, home to a diverse range of wildlife from around the world. Marvel at tigers, elephants, giraffes, and many other fascinating animals. The zoo also has an impressive collection of birds. Admission fee: INR 60 for adults, INR 30 for children. Plan to spend approximately 2 hours exploring the zoo.

4:00 PM: Mysore Silk Factory

Discover the art of silk weaving by visiting a Mysore Silk Factory. Witness skilled artisans weaving intricate patterns and designs on silk sarees. You can purchase exquisite silk garments and accessories here. There is no entry fee, and you can spend around 1 hour exploring the factory and shopping.

6:00 PM: Brindavan Gardens

Conclude your day by visiting the enchanting Brindavan Gardens. Located near the Krishnarajasagara Dam, these beautifully manicured gardens are famous for their musical fountain show. Enjoy a pleasant stroll amidst colorful flowers, fountains, and light displays. Entry fee: INR 20 for adults, INR 10 for children. Time spent: 2 hours.

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ique experience, consider visiting the St. Philomena's Cathedral, an architectural marvel with beautiful stained glass windows and a serene ambiance. Another off-the-beaten-path attraction is the Mysore Sand Sculpture Museum, where you can admire intricate sand sculptures created by talented artists. Locals also love to unwind at the Karanji Lake, a peaceful oasis offering boating and bird-watching opportunities.
